Definition of barb
Thanks for using this online dictionary, we have been helping millions of people improve their use of the english language with its free online services. English definition of barb is as below...
Barb (n.) The
Barbary
horse,
a
superior
breed
introduced
from
Barbary
into Spain by the
Moors..
